Significance of Teen Driving Lessons
Driving is not merely about obtaining from point A to point B; it includes comprehending traffic laws, mastering automobile control, and establishing defensive driving skills. Teen driving lessons are vital for a number of reasons:
Safety: Young drivers are at a greater danger for mishaps. Correct training can decrease this danger significantly.Understanding of Rules: Driving lessons stress state-specific traffic laws, regulations, and road indications, promoting responsible behavior on the road.Building Confidence: With thorough lessons, teens acquire the confidence required to manage different driving scenarios, making them more careful and competent chauffeurs.Knowing Defensive Driving: Teens are taught how to prepare for and respond to other motorists' actions, which is important for preventing collisions.Insurance Benefits: Many insurance provider provide discount rates to young chauffeurs who finish an accredited driving program, leading to monetary savings for households.What to Expect in Teen Driving LessonsLesson Structure
Teen driving lessons usually follow a structured curriculum. Here's a breakdown of what students can anticipate:
Lesson ComponentDescriptionTheory ClassesLearning the guidelines of the road, understanding traffic signs, and laws.Simulator PracticeUtilizing driving simulators to practice standard skills in a regulated environment.In-Car InstructionHands-on experience with a trainer assisting the student through various driving circumstances.Night DrivingParticular lessons focused on driving at night, highlighting presence and awareness.Defensive DrivingTechniques for preparing for potential hazards and making notified choices.Highway DrivingInstruction on browsing expressways and comprehending merging and lane modifications.Skills Developed
Some skills teens will learn during their driving lessons consist of:
Vehicle Control: Steering, braking, velocity, and navigating the car.Parking Skills: Parallel parking, angle parking, and parking on hills.Traffic Management: Navigating crossways, traffic signals, and roundabouts.Adverse Conditions: Driving in rain, snow, or fog, and how to react to emergencies.Navigation: Understanding road indications, signals, and map-reading.Tips for Successful Teen Driving Education

What is the very best age to begin driving lessons?
A lot of states permit teenagers to begin discovering to drive at 15 or 16 years old. However, it is necessary to examine the particular guidelines in your state.
2. The number of lessons are normally needed?
The variety of lessons can differ based upon specific skill and comfort level, however most programs advise 6-10 lessons before a driving test.
3. Do I require to take a driving course to get my license?
In lots of states, finishing a driver's education course is required or extremely suggested. Examine local requirements for specifics.
4. What should I try to find in a driving school?
Look for certified programs, qualified instructors, favorable reviews, and versatile scheduling choices.
5. Exist financial benefits to taking driving lessons?
Yes, numerous insurance provider provide discount rates for young chauffeurs who complete an authorized driving program.
